Deploy step 4: Crashhopper ingest tier. Drain old workers, then roll the new image to the ingest pool one node at a time. Verify symbol uploads resume before proceeding; check the Fennelgate dashboard for a green ingest lag panel. New workers will crash-loop until the dedup store credential is present in the environment. On each node, edit /etc/crashhopper/.env and append the following line, then restart the service:

env line for kahof-yahag: RELAY_SECRET5=224bf

Plugin authors are reporting 3–6s cold starts when handlers import the full Fenwick SDK. Profiling shows most time is spent resolving optional transitive dependencies that plugins rarely use. We're shipping a slimmed runtime image and lazy-loading the storage client, which cuts cold starts to under 800ms in our tests. Plugin authors should update manifests to declare only the capabilities they use; undeclared capabilities will no longer be preloaded. Please retest your plugins against the build below.

pipeline stamp: htk3_69f

Visits to the Brackenhold data-centre cage at our Eastvale facility must be booked at least two working days in advance through the Faraday scheduling desk. Assistants arranging visits should confirm that every attendee has completed the annual safety briefing, as unbriefed visitors will be turned away at the gatehouse. Escorts are mandatory inside the cage corridor at all times, and photography is prohibited. Escorting staff should enter using the door code below.

door code, kawip-bagap: bdg-HQEWH-4

The Cartwheel tile prefetcher warms regional caches by requesting map tiles ahead of predicted user movement. All prefetch calls are server-to-server and must carry a bearer credential scoped to the tile-read permission only; the prefetcher cannot write or invalidate tiles. Requests are rate-limited per zoom level, and anomalous fetch patterns trigger an alert to the Lanternway security channel. For audit purposes, the reviewer sandbox uses a dedicated credential that is rotated monthly. The current sandbox key follows.

app token of bahaf-tajeg = zpat23_SjjsllwiLmXbtS65veZaV47